Recipe Tips and Tricks

You can make your tart cases from scratch, but I recommend using pre-made ones for ease!

  • If you make your own cases, just be careful not to overmix the pastry or worry about it looking perfect.
  • Don’t be afraid to make your tarts in batches if you’re working with a smaller tray. You don’t want them to be touching while they’re baking.
  • If you don’t think the recipe is going to be quite sweet enough, you can sprinkle just a bit of sugar on top of each tart.
  • Keep the tart ingredients at room temperature before using them. This will prevent any cool shock when they go into the oven!
  • Don’t overfill your tarts. I get that it can be tempting to go overboard, but you don’t want to overfill your tarts or the filling may bubble over the sides.

Variations and Substitutions

  • Depending on your taste, you can use raspberry, apricot, or cherry jam in place of the strawberry!
  • Desiccated coconut works best for this recipe. But if you want to, you can switch things up with ground almonds or other nuts for a different flavor.

Storage Instructions

These strawberry coconut tarts will easily keep for 3-5 days if you store them carefully.

I suggest putting them in an airtight container for best results, but you can also keep them in a regular container if you don’t have one.

Just be warned that they may go stale much faster this way.

Can I Freeze?

You can certainly freeze these strawberry coconut tarts!

Wait for them to cool completely before storing them separately in freezer-safe bags for up to a month.

Strawberry Coconut Tarts

Created by Stacie Vaughan

Servings 12

Prep Time 10 minutes minutes

Cook Time 20 minutes minutes

Total Time 30 minutes minutes

Tiny tarts perfect for parties! Strawberry jam is surrounded by a coconut pie.

Rate this Recipe

Ingredients

  • ½ cup salted butter softened
  • ½ cup s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up shredded sweetened coconut
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• ¼ cup strawberry jam
  • 12 frozen tart shells thawed

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350℉.

  • Beat butter, sugar and eggs in a large bowl until smooth. Stir in coconut and vanilla.

  • Place tarts on a baking sheet. Spoon 1 tsp jam into each tart. Top with 1 tbsp of coconut mixture.

  • Bake for 15 to 20 minutes, or until golden brown on top. Cool on a cooling rack before serving.

Why are baked tart shells without a filling docked before baking? ›

With docking, the holes allow steam to escape, so the crust should stay flat against the baking dish when it isn't held down by pie weights or a filling.

Why is my tart base so hard? ›

Richard's solution: Tough pastry is very common, but easily avoidable. It usually occurs when you've been a bit heavy-handed with the water when you're initially bringing the pastry together (by adding water to the flour and butter), or if you have over-worked the dough and developed the gluten in the flour.

How do you keep jam from crystallizing? ›

Do not stir the jam as it cools before you put it into the jars. Make sure the jars are spotlessly clean. If a jam does crystallise, reheat it, add a little lemon juice to inhibit crystallisation and pour into a clean jar.
